    This still isn't right and reads a bit ChatGPT. When I suggested Googling it I didn't mean use an American bot to write it.

    You did get a NTK (the final reminder that cites para 8 of the POFA is trying to be a hybrid NTK, following what they are calling a postal Notice to Driver).  None of it makes sense, as there is no such thing as a postal Notice to Driver.
    Sorry for using Chat GPT, I have now amended this. Please see below and advise. 

    I am writing to formally complain about the recent Parking Charge Notice (PCN) number 123456789 issued on 27/9/2024.

    I question the validity of this PCN on the following grounds:

     * The first notice received was a final reminder, denying the keeper the opportunity to pay the discounted amount or appeal the PCN.

     * Inconsistent Citation of Regulations: The PCN was issued 'by post,' yet it cites paragraph 8 of Schedule 4 of the Protections of Freedoms Act 2012. This paragraph exclusively pertains to windscreen PCNs.

    I request the following:

     * Evidence of First PCN: Please provide verifiable evidence substantiating the existence of the supposed first PCN, including proof of postage and delivery.

    If Euro Car Parks fails to address this complaint satisfactorily, I will be forced to escalate this matter to the BPA.

    Dear Sirs,

    It is a complaint, not a SAR.  If I'd wanted a SAR I would have emailed your DPO but I didn't.  I used your complaints procedure.

    Get over yourselves and reply to my complaint; this is getting silly now.  Attached is a copy of the vehicle v5C which shows I am the keeper.
